Crawlspace waterproofing services focus on preventing moisture intrusion and water damage beneath a building. These services typically involve installing vapor barriers, sealing cracks, and applying drainage systems to manage water flow effectively. The goal is to create a dry, stable environment in the crawlspace, which can help protect the structural integrity of the property and improve indoor air quality by reducing mold and mildew growth caused by excess moisture.

Addressing water infiltration issues, crawlspace waterproofing can help resolve problems such as persistent dampness, musty odors, and wood rot. Excess moisture in the crawlspace can lead to structural deterioration over time, including weakened beams and supports. Waterproofing solutions are designed to mitigate these risks by directing water away from the foundation and preventing it from seeping into the space, thereby maintaining the property's stability and reducing the potential for costly repairs.

Properties that typically benefit from crawlspace waterproofing include residential homes, especially those in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high humidity. Older homes with inadequate drainage systems or homes built on flood-prone land are often good candidates for these services. Commercial buildings with crawlspaces or basements that require moisture control and structural protection may also utilize waterproofing solutions to ensure a dry environment and prevent damage caused by water infiltration.

The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Acton,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Basic Waterproofing - Typical costs for basic crawlspace waterproofing range from $1,500 to $3,500, depending on the size and condition of the area. This includes sealing minor cracks and installing a vapor barrier. Prices may vary based on local contractor rates and specific project needs.

Full Encapsulation - Full encapsulation services usually cost between $4,000 and $10,000. This process involves sealing the entire crawlspace with a vapor barrier and installing a dehumidification system, which can influence the overall cost.

Drainage System Installation - Installing interior or exterior drainage systems typically falls within a $2,500 to $7,000 range. Costs depend on the extent of excavation and the complexity of the drainage setup required for effective moisture control.

Additional Repairs - Repairing foundation cracks or installing sump pumps can add $500 to $3,000 to the project. These costs vary based on the severity of the issues and the necessary scope of repairs, as estimated by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
